When asked why he did it, Goleta area man, Nicolas Holzer, said, ” I had to,” after he was arrested on charges of slaughtering his family and dog with kitchen knives, thought to be the murder weapons,  late Monday night in southern California.

Up until this incident in Santa Barbara county, 45-year-old Holzer had a clean criminal history and authorities as yet have no motive in the killings of Hilzer’s parents, 73-year-old William Holzer, 74-year-old Sheila Holzer, and Holzer’s two sons, 13-year-old Sebastian and 10-year-old Vincent.

Holzer was arrested without incident when authorities responded to his parent’s home after Holzer called 9-1-1 to report what he had done. He met them at the door.

Holzer related to police that he killed his family because he believed it was his destiny. Detectives in the case are looking at Holzer’s mental health officials say.

Investigators believe that Holzer first stabbed to death his father in the family den, then killed his two sleeping sons in their beds, then killed his mother, who was found at the doorway to the bedroom. Sometime during the tragic incident, Holzer also killed the family dog.

Holzer was divorced from his wife in 2006 and had been living with his parents for the last seven years.

Holzer has been arrested and charged with four counts of Murder and is being held without bail at the Santa Barbara Jail.
